How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ward Two?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ward Two Studio Apartments | $2,726 | $1,696 | $3,607 |
| Ward Two 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,895 | $1,250 | $5,791 |
| Ward Two 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,478 | $2,000 | $10,000+ |
| Ward Two 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,800 | $1,300 | $7,580 |
| Ward Two 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,787 | $3,000 | $7,395 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Ward Two
What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the Ward Two area of Somerville, MA?
As of today, September 07, 2026, there are currently 841 available Ward Two apartments priced from $1,250 to $13,171, with an average monthly rent of $3,541.
How much are Studio apartments in Ward Two?
There are currently 177 Studio Apartments in Ward Two with rent ranges from $1,696 to $3,607 with an average price of $2,726.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Ward Two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Ward Two ranges from $1,250 to $5,791 with an average monthly rent of $2,895.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Ward Two c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Ward Two range from $2,000 to $13,171.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,478.
How expensive are Ward Two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 182 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Ward Two on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,300 to $7,580 - averaging $3,800 for the location.
